Core Features
Safety Data Sheet (SDS) Management: Centralized SDS repository with version control and regulatory alignment.
Chemical Inventory Management: Tracking of hazardous substances across sites and departments.
Regulatory Compliance Monitoring: Support for REACH, CLP, and other chemical safety frameworks.
Risk Assessment & Incident Management: Tools to document and manage safety risks and incidents.
Compliance Reporting: Generation of structured compliance documentation.
Multi-Site Management: Centralized oversight for organisations operating across multiple facilities.
Workflow Automation: Automated notifications, document updates, and compliance tasks.
Plans & Pricing
Denxpert operates under:
Enterprise subscription agreements.
Module-based pricing.
Custom implementation packages.
Pricing depends on:
Number of users.
Number of facilities.
Regulatory modules required.
Integration complexity.
Public pricing tiers are not disclosed.

From a Net Zero Compare perspective:
It supports environmental compliance and chemical risk management.
It does not provide enterprise-wide carbon accounting.
It should not be classified as a climate strategy or ESG financial reporting system without explicit Scope 1–3 capabilities.

Closing Insights
Denxpert should be positioned as an EHS & Chemical Compliance Management Platform. Its core strength lies in safety data management and regulatory compliance workflows. While it contributes to environmental governance and operational risk reduction, it is not a carbon accounting or net zero transition analytics platform.
